Australia’s centre-left swings back into victory opening a new era of progress

Australia’s centre-left swings back into victory opening a new era of progress

After many years of conservative politics ruling Australia voters have finally had enough, booting out Scott Morrison’s scandal laden administration. The election of the Australian Labor Party’s Anthony Albanese has been welcomed by world leaders and civil society advocates who see this as the moment to achieve transformational change in the Indo-Pacific region on climate, trade, and a slew of issues.

PES condemns upheld prison sentence for Turkish opposition politician Canan Kaftancıoğlu

PES condemns upheld prison sentence for Turkish opposition politician Canan Kaftancıoğlu

The Supreme Court of Appeals in Turkey has today denied justice to Canan Kaftancıoğlu, Istanbul chairperson of the main opposition Republican People’s Party (CHP) – a PES associate member party.
